The Data Problem Accounting Firms Can't Ignore
Accounting runs on trust. Clients hand over their financial lives — tax returns, payroll records, business financials, personal bank statements — because they trust you to protect them. Every time that data passes through a cloud AI service, that trust gets harder to defend.
Most cloud AI platforms train on user data by default. If your tax preparation software or AI assistant is processing client returns through a cloud model, you could be embedding your clients' financial information into a public AI system without their knowledge. That's not just a privacy breach — it's a professional liability.
Where Local AI Makes the Biggest Impact
Tax preparation. A local AI can scan receipts, categorize deductions, flag missing documents, and draft return summaries — all on your office network. No client financial data ever leaves your control.
Bookkeeping automation. Receipt scanning, invoice categorization, bank reconciliation, expense tracking. Hours of manual data entry reduced to minutes, processed entirely on your hardware.
Client reporting. Generate draft financial statements, quarterly reports, and management summaries from your existing accounting data. The AI works with your files where they already live.
Audit support. Organize documentation, flag anomalies, prepare responses — without ever sending client records to an external service.
What a Local AI Setup Looks Like for an Accounting Firm
We set up a small computer on your office network running open-source AI models. Your existing accounting software connects to it through local APIs — no cloud bridges, no data leaving your building. The system can:
- Scan and categorize receipts and invoices automatically
- Reconcile bank transactions against your ledgers
- Generate draft tax return summaries for review
- Create client-ready financial reports from your data
- Flag anomalies and missing documentation for follow-up
Compliance Built In
When nothing leaves your network, compliance becomes straightforward. No BAAs to negotiate with AI vendors. No data processing agreements. No wondering whether client information is being used to train someone else's models. Your data stays on your systems, under your policies.
For accounting firms dealing with seasonal rushes — tax season especially — local AI means you can scale your capacity without scaling your risk.
